    Yes, the sequence is

    1. Capture, Destroy former owner's Gov building (I also usually destroy any building that is not a wonder and not in my own building tree, except I might wait with temples for income, experience or pacification reasons, same for other buildings helping with such), build Regional Pacification.

    Next turn Reg Pac finishes and you can decide what gov building you want and start it.

    Remember also that the more buildings you have of a different culture in your province, the greater your culture penalty for Public Order.

    For example if I was playing as Romani and captured Taras, I would look to knock down all buildings I cannot upgrade that have Greek culture, and upgrade those I can upgrade ASAP.

    Sometimes it is worthwhile knocking down an apparently useful building so you can increase taxes/reduce garrison requirements in the short term. Knocking down a +5% public order building that is giving you -5% public order from cultural penalty is a net gain of about 400 mnai. Leave it there and it does nothing for you.

    This is unfortunately a great motivation to rush as you cannot knockdown or upgrade the final levels of Walls/Governor Residence/Roads/Farming while will all add to culture pentalty public order negative modifiers.
